Understanding what is application software is the first step to learning how computers and mobile devices actually help us in daily life. Application software refers to programs that are designed to perform specific tasks for users, such as writing documents, browsing websites, creating presentations, editing images, or communicating with others. Unlike system software, which runs the computer itself, application software is made for the user’s direct use. It acts as a bridge between human needs and computer functionality, making digital work simple, fast, and efficient.
In today’s modern world, application software is everywhere. Every time you open WhatsApp to send a message, use Google Chrome to search information, or watch videos on YouTube, you are using application software. These programs run on computers, laptops, tablets, and smartphones, helping people in education, business, entertainment, and communication. Without application software, computers would be difficult to use for everyday tasks because users would not have easy tools to interact with the system.
Definition of what application software is
What is application software refers to computer programs or mobile apps that are designed to help users perform specific tasks, such as writing documents, browsing the internet, sending emails, creating presentations, editing images, or watching videos. It is user-focused software, meaning it is made to directly support the needs of people rather than controlling the computer system. Application software works on top of system software like Windows, Android, or macOS, and it cannot function without it. In simple words, application software is the tool you use on a computer or mobile to complete your daily digital tasks easily and efficiently.
Simple Definition in Easy English
In easy English, application software is a type of program that helps you do work on a computer or phone. It does not run the system itself but allows you to perform tasks like typing, calculating, designing, or chatting. It makes computers useful for normal users by giving them ready-made tools to complete different jobs without needing technical knowledge.
Key points:
- It is a program or app used by people
- It helps in performing specific tasks
- It is easy to use and user-friendly
- It depends on the system software to run
- It works on computers, laptops, and mobile phones
How it Works on a Computer or Mobile
Application software works by interacting with system software, which manages the computer’s hardware. When you open an app, the system software loads it into memory (RAM) and gives it access to resources like the processor and storage. Then the application performs the task you selected, such as playing a video or saving a file. This process happens very quickly, making the user experience smooth and efficient.
Key points:
- User opens the application
- System software loads the app into memory
- App uses CPU, storage, and memory through system support
- Task is performed (e.g., typing, browsing, editing)
- The result is shown to the user in real time
Real-World Explanation
In real life, application software works like tools in daily life. Just like you use different tools for different jobs, you use different apps for different digital tasks. For example, students use Google Docs for writing assignments, workers use Excel for calculations, and people use WhatsApp for communication. Each application is designed for a specific purpose, making technology simple, useful, and accessible for everyone.
Key points:
- Different apps are used for different tasks
- Makes daily work easier and faster
- Used in education, business, and entertainment
- Removes the need for manual or complex work
- Improves productivity and communication
Read Also: how to check for software updates
Characteristics of Application Software

Application software has several important characteristics that explain how it is designed, how it works, and why it is useful for everyday computer and mobile users. These characteristics show that application software is not meant to control the computer system itself, but instead to help users complete specific tasks in a simple and efficient way. Understanding these features makes it easier to clearly understand what is application software and how it supports modern digital life.
User-focused design
Application software is always designed with the user in mind. Its main purpose is to make technology easy for people who may not have technical knowledge. Developers create application software in a way that normal users can easily understand and operate it without needing to learn complex programming or system functions. This means everything in the software—buttons, menus, icons, and features—is arranged to help the user complete tasks quickly. Whether someone is writing a document, editing a photo, or sending a message, the design is focused on making the process smooth and simple.
Key points:
- Designed for everyday users, not technical experts
- Focuses on simplicity and ease of use
- Reduces the need for technical knowledge
- Helps users complete tasks quickly and efficiently
- Improves user experience through clear layout and navigation
Task-specific function
One of the most important features of application software is that it is created for specific tasks. Unlike system software, which manages the entire computer, application software is built to perform a particular job or group of related tasks. For example, Microsoft Word is used for writing documents, Excel is used for calculations and data management, and Photoshop is used for image editing. Each software has its own clear purpose and tools that match that purpose. This specialization helps users avoid confusion and increases productivity because they are using tools designed exactly for their needs.
Key points:
- Each software has a specific purpose or function
- Focuses on one category of work (writing, browsing, editing, etc.)
- Increases productivity by reducing unnecessary features
- Helps users complete tasks more accurately
- Provides specialized tools for different jobs
Easy interface
Application software is designed with a simple and user-friendly interface, which means the way it looks and works is easy to understand. The interface includes menus, icons, buttons, and visual elements that guide the user step by step. Even a beginner can learn how to use most applications without formal training. This simplicity is very important because users interact directly with application software every day. A good interface reduces confusion, saves time, and allows users to focus on their work instead of learning complicated systems. Modern applications also use graphics, touch controls, and voice commands to make usage even easier.
Key points:
- Simple layout with clear instructions
- Uses icons, menus, and buttons for easy navigation
- Designed for beginners and advanced users
- Reduces learning time and effort
- Improves the speed and efficiency of work
Requires system software support
Application software cannot function on its own. It always depends on system software, such as an operating system (Windows, Android, macOS, Linux), to run properly. The system software acts as a bridge between the application and the computer hardware. When a user opens an application, the system software loads it into memory and provides access to hardware resources like CPU, RAM, and storage. Without this support, application software would not be able to perform any task. This dependency makes system software essential for every application to function correctly.
Key points:
- Depends on the operating system to run
- Cannot work independently without system software
- Uses hardware resources through system control
- System software manages memory and processing for apps
- Ensures smooth execution of application tasks
Types of Application Software
Application software is divided into different categories based on the type of tasks it performs for users. Each type is designed to solve a specific problem, such as writing documents, managing data, creating presentations, browsing the internet, or using mobile apps. These categories make it easier to understand how what is application software works in real-life situations. In simple terms, each type of application software has its own role that helps users complete their work more efficiently and quickly.
Word Processing Software
Word processing software is designed to help users create, edit, format, and store text documents in a simple and organized way. It is one of the most commonly used application software in education, offices, and businesses because it allows users to write everything from letters and assignments to reports and resumes. This software also provides tools like spelling and grammar checking, text formatting, and page layout options, which make documents more professional and easier to read.
In real-life use, word processing software saves a lot of time and effort because users do not need to write documents manually. Instead, they can type, edit, and make changes easily without starting from scratch. It also allows users to save documents digitally and share them through email or cloud storage, making it highly useful in modern digital communication.
Spreadsheet Software
Spreadsheet software is used for organizing, calculating, and analyzing numerical data in a structured format of rows and columns. It is widely used in fields like accounting, finance, business management, and data analysis because it can handle large amounts of data efficiently. This software also supports formulas and functions that automatically perform calculations, reducing human error and saving time.
In practical use, spreadsheet software helps businesses and individuals manage budgets, track expenses, create financial reports, and analyze data trends. For example, companies use it to calculate salaries, students use it for data projects, and banks use it for financial records. Its ability to perform automatic calculations makes it one of the most powerful types of application software.
Presentation Software
Presentation software is used to create visual slides that help users present information in meetings, classrooms, and business environments. It allows users to combine text, images, charts, animations, and videos to make content more engaging and easier to understand. This type of software is especially useful for explaining complex ideas in a simple and visual format.
In real-world applications, presentation software is widely used by students for project presentations, teachers for lectures, and professionals for business meetings. It helps improve communication by turning plain information into attractive visual slides that keep the audience interested and focused.
Web-Based Applications
Web-based applications are programs that run directly in a web browser without needing installation on a device. These applications work through the internet and can be accessed from anywhere using devices like laptops, tablets, or smartphones. They are commonly used for online communication, file storage, and collaborative work.
In daily life, web-based applications make it easier for people to work remotely and share information instantly. Examples include email services, cloud storage platforms, and online editing tools. Their biggest advantage is accessibility, as users only need an internet connection to use them from any location.
Mobile Applications
Mobile applications are software programs specially designed for smartphones and tablets. These apps are downloaded from app stores and are optimized for touch screens and mobile devices. They are used for a wide range of activities such as messaging, social media, banking, shopping, entertainment, and learning.
In real-life usage, mobile applications have become an essential part of daily life because they provide quick and easy access to services anytime and anywhere. For example, people use WhatsApp for communication, Instagram for sharing photos, and banking apps for online transactions. Their portability and convenience make them one of the most important forms of application software today.
Examples of Application Software
Application software includes many real-world programs and apps that people use every day to perform different tasks on computers and mobile devices. These software programs are designed to solve specific problems such as writing documents, browsing the internet, managing data, editing images, and communicating with others. When we understand what is application software, real-life examples help us clearly see how important and useful it is in daily life.
Real-life examples list
Application software includes a wide range of tools used in education, business, and personal life. These tools are designed to perform specific tasks such as writing documents, managing data, communicating online, editing images, and accessing information through the internet. Each application is created with a particular purpose, which makes it easier for users to complete their daily digital activities efficiently and without technical difficulty. This variety of software shows how important what is application software is in modern computing because it supports almost every area of human activity.
Key points:
- Microsoft Word – used for creating and editing documents
- Microsoft Excel – used for calculations and data management
- Microsoft PowerPoint – used for making presentations
- Google Chrome – used for browsing the internet
- WhatsApp – used for messaging and communication
- Zoom – used for online meetings and video calls
- Adobe Photoshop – used for photo editing and design
- YouTube – used for watching and sharing videos
Explanation of each category
Application software is divided into different categories based on the type of work it does. Each category is designed to perform a specific task, such as writing documents, calculating data, creating presentations, or browsing the internet. This division helps users easily choose the right software for their needs and complete their work in a simple and organized way.
Key points:
- Word Processing Software: used for typing and editing text documents (e.g., MS Word)
- Spreadsheet Software: used for calculations and data analysis (e.g., Excel)
- Presentation Software: used to create slide shows for meetings or classes (e.g., PowerPoint)
- Web Browsers: used to access internet information (e.g., Chrome, Firefox)
- Communication Apps: used for chatting and video calls (e.g., WhatsApp, Zoom)
- Graphic Design Software: used for editing images and creating designs (e.g., Photoshop)
Daily usage impact
Application software plays an important role in daily life because it makes almost every digital task simple, fast, and well-organized. It is widely used in schools for learning and assignments, in offices for reports and communication, and in businesses for managing data and operations. At home, people use it for entertainment, messaging, online shopping, and social media. Overall, it improves productivity and makes technology easy to use for everyone.
Key points:
- Helps students complete assignments and learning tasks easily
- Supports businesses in communication, planning, and data management
- Makes online communication faster through messaging and video calls
- Provides entertainment through videos, games, and social media
- Saves time and increases productivity in daily work
- Makes technology easy for non-technical users
Difference Between System Software and Application Software
System software and application software are two main types of computer software, but both work for completely different purposes. System software is responsible for running and controlling the computer system, while application software is designed to help users perform specific tasks like writing, browsing, or editing. Understanding this difference is important to clearly understand what is application software and how it works with system software.
Feature Comparison
| Feature | System Software | Application Software |
| Purpose | Controls and manages computer hardware and system operations | Helps users perform specific tasks |
| Example | Windows, Linux, macOS | MS Word, Google Chrome, WhatsApp |
| User interaction | Low (works in the background) | High (used directly by users) |
Uses of Application Software
Application software is widely used in many areas of life because it helps people perform different tasks easily and efficiently. It is designed to make daily work faster, simpler, and more organized. Understanding what is application software becomes more practical when we look at its real uses in different fields such as education, business, communication, and entertainment.
Education
Application software is very important in education because it supports both students and teachers in learning and teaching activities. It helps make education more effective by providing digital tools for writing, reading, research, and presentations. With the help of application software, students can easily complete assignments, access online study materials, and improve their understanding of different subjects in a simple way.
Key points:
- Used for online learning and digital classrooms
- Helps students complete assignments and projects
- Tools like MS Word and Google Docs are used for writing work
- Presentation software is used for lectures and explanations
- Educational apps support self-learning anytime
Business
In business, application software plays an important role in improving efficiency and organizing work in a professional way. It helps companies manage large amounts of data, such as customer records, sales information, and financial reports, in a simple and structured manner. This makes it easier for businesses to make better decisions and track their performance.
Key points:
- Used for accounting, finance, and data management
- Helps in creating reports and presentations
- Improves communication through emails and messaging apps
- Supports online meetings and teamwork (Zoom, Teams)
- Helps in business planning and decision-making
Communication
Application software plays an important role in communication by making it fast, simple, and more effective for people around the world. It allows users to stay connected instantly through different digital platforms without any delay or difficulty. This has changed the way people interact in both personal and professional life. It enables instant messaging, voice calls, and video calls through apps like WhatsApp, Zoom, and Skype. Users can also share files, images, and documents in real time, which improves communication speed and efficiency.
Key points:
- Used for messaging and chatting (WhatsApp, Messenger)
- Supports video calls and online meetings (Zoom, Skype)
- Helps share files, images, and documents instantly
- Makes global communication possible
- Improves personal and professional interaction
Entertainment
Application software also plays an important role in entertainment by providing users with fun, interactive, and engaging digital content. It allows people to enjoy different types of media such as videos, music, games, and social media content on their devices. This makes free time more enjoyable and relaxing. It helps users access platforms like YouTube, Netflix, Spotify, and gaming apps where they can watch movies, listen to music, and play games anytime.
Key points:
- Used for watching videos (YouTube, Netflix)
- Supports music streaming and gaming apps
- Social media apps provide entertainment and engagement
- Helps users explore photos, reels, and live content
- Makes digital entertainment accessible anytime
Advantages and Limitations of Application Software
Application software is very useful in daily life because it helps users perform different tasks easily on computers and mobile devices. However, like every technology, it also has some limitations. Understanding what is application software becomes more complete when we look at both its benefits and drawbacks.
Advantages
Application software offers many benefits that make digital work faster, easier, and more efficient for users in education, business, and personal use. It helps people complete their tasks with less effort by providing ready-made tools for writing, calculating, designing, communicating, and managing information. This improves overall productivity and allows users to focus more on their work instead of technical difficulties.
Key points:
- Easy to use: Most application software has a simple interface that beginners can understand without technical skills
- Improves productivity: It helps users complete tasks faster, such as writing, calculating, and designing
- Saves time: Automatic tools reduce manual work and speed up processes
- Better communication: Apps make messaging, video calls, and file sharing simple and quick
- Organized work: Helps users store, manage, and access data easily
Limitations
Despite its advantages, application software also has some limitations that users should understand before using it. Some applications depend heavily on system software and cannot work without it, while others may require a strong internet connection or high-performance devices. In addition, some advanced application software can be expensive and may require paid subscriptions or licenses. There are also security risks, as poorly protected software can expose user data to threats or cyberattacks.
Key points:
- Requires system support: It cannot run without system software like Windows or Android
- Can be costly: Some advanced applications require paid licenses or subscriptions
- Internet dependency: Many modern apps need internet access to function properly
- System requirements: Some software needs high-performance devices to run smoothly
- Security risks: Poorly secured applications may expose data to threats
Common Mistakes in Understanding Application Software
Many learners make mistakes when trying to understand what is application software because they often confuse it with other types of software or do not clearly understand its purpose and categories. This confusion happens because both system software and application software work together, but they have different roles in a computer system. As a result, beginners sometimes mix their functions and fail to see the clear difference between them.
Confusing it with system software
One of the most common mistakes is mixing application software with system software. Many people think both are the same, but they are completely different in purpose and function. System software runs the computer and manages hardware, while application software helps users perform tasks like writing, browsing, or editing.
Key points:
- System software controls the computer system
- Application software is used by users for tasks
- They serve different purposes
- Application software depends on system software to run
Thinking all apps are the same
Another mistake is believing that all applications work in the same way. In reality, application software is divided into different types, such as word processing, spreadsheets, presentation tools, and mobile apps. Each application is designed for a specific task, and using the wrong tool can reduce efficiency and productivity.
Key points:
- Different apps have different functions
- Each software is designed for a specific purpose
- Examples include Word for writing and Excel for calculations
- Not all applications perform the same tasks
Ignoring categories
Some users ignore the classification of application software, which often leads to confusion when selecting the right tools for different tasks. When users do not understand that application software is divided into categories like word processing, spreadsheets, presentations, and communication tools, they may struggle to identify which software is suitable for a specific job. As a result, they may waste time exploring the wrong applications or using tools that are not designed for their needs.
Key points:
- Application software is divided into categories
- Each category serves a specific function
- Helps in selecting the right tool for the job
- Improves efficiency and reduces confusion
Frequently Asked Questions
What is application software in simple words?
Application software is a program or app that helps users perform specific tasks on a computer or mobile device, such as writing documents, browsing the internet, or sending messages.
What are examples of application software?
Common examples include Microsoft Word, Excel, PowerPoint, Google Chrome, WhatsApp, Zoom, and Adobe Photoshop. Each is used for a different purpose.
What is the main purpose of application software?
The main purpose is to help users complete specific tasks easily, such as creating documents, managing data, communicating, and enjoying entertainment.
Can application software work without system software?
No, application software cannot work without system software like Windows, Android, or macOS because it depends on it to run.
Why is application software important?
It is important because it makes digital tasks faster, easier, and more organized in education, business, communication, and daily life.
Conclusion
Understanding what is application software is very important for anyone learning computer basics. Application software refers to programs designed to help users perform specific tasks such as writing documents, browsing the internet, creating presentations, managing data, and communicating with others. It plays a key role in making computers and mobile devices useful in everyday life.
Overall, application software is an essential part of modern technology because it is used in education, business, communication, and entertainment. It saves time, improves productivity, and makes digital work easier and more organized. Without application software, it would be difficult for users to complete daily tasks efficiently in today’s digital world.
